#399497 hex color

In a RGB color space, hex #399497 is composed of 22.4% red, 58% green and 59.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 62.3% cyan, 2% magenta, 0% yellow and 40.8% black. It has a hue angle of 181.9 degrees, a saturation of 45.2% and a lightness of 40.8%. #399497 color hex could be obtained by blending #72ffff with #00292f. Closest websafe color is: #339999.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030809 is the darkest color, while #f9fdfd is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#616f6f is the less saturated color, while #01c8cf is the most saturated one.
